欢迎访问宙启技术站
智能推送

Tushare实现A股市场交易数据的实时监测与分析

发布时间:2024-01-08 22:16:46

Tushare是一款基于Python的开源金融数据接口工具,它提供了丰富的A股市场交易数据,并且支持实时监测与分析。下面将介绍Tushare如何实现A股市场交易数据的实时监测与分析,并提供一个使用例子。

首先,我们需要在Python环境中安装Tushare模块。可以通过以下命令进行安装:

pip install tushare

接下来,我们需要在Tushare官网(https://tushare.pro/)上申请并获取到一个Token,这个Token将用于我们获取实时交易数据。

有了Token之后,我们就可以开始使用Tushare提供的接口获取A股市场的实时交易数据。以下是一个简单的例子,演示如何使用Tushare实时监测A股市场的交易数据。

import tushare as ts

# 设置Tushare接口的Token
ts.set_token('your_token')

# 初始化Tushare接口
pro = ts.pro_api()

# 获取实时行情数据
df = pro.realtime_quotes(ts_code='000001.SZ')

# 打印实时行情数据
print(df)

在上面的例子中,我们首先设置了Tushare接口的Token,然后初始化了Tushare接口。接下来,我们使用realtime_quotes函数获取了股票代码为000001.SZ(上证指数)的实时行情数据。最后,我们打印了获取到的实时行情数据。

通过这个例子,我们可以看到使用Tushare获取A股市场交易数据非常简单和方便。实际上,Tushare还提供了更多丰富的接口用于获取其他类型的交易数据,比如历史行情数据、财务报表数据等。我们可以根据自己的需求,使用这些接口进行实时监测和分析。

总结来说,Tushare是一个功能强大的金融数据接口工具,可以帮助我们实现A股市场交易数据的实时监测与分析。通过使用Tushare,我们可以轻松地获取各种类型的交易数据,并进行进一步的处理和分析。希望这个例子能够帮助大家更好地理解和使用Tushare。